✅ What Makes an Orthopedic Bed “Orthopedic”?

  • Minimum 2–4 in of high‑density memory foam to support joints.
  • Even weight distribution reduces pressure on hips/elbows.
  • Raised or floor-level? Bolsters add neck support; flat mats easier for arthritis dogs to access.

🛠️ How to Choose the Right One

  • Measure your dog: allow full stretch; add a few inches.
  • Foam thickness: seniors + large breeds need 4″+, medium dogs 2–3″.
  • Bolsters? Choose based on sleep style: curled vs stretched.
  • Durability: cloth vs ballistic fabric for chewers/activity.
  • Cover: washable & waterproof preferred for older or incontinent dogs.
